One or more modules are defective. Check the V oc of each module in a string to determine whether there are any defective modules. For long strings, divide the string in half and decide which half is faulty.. Clean the modules with a mild soap and water solution. With the right approach, you can get back to enjoying the benefits of renewable energy. . Checking the battery voltage is the first step in troubleshooting a dead battery. Determine the battery's voltage by using a multimeter. It could be necessary to replace the battery if the voltage drops below the suggested level. But, it's crucial to make sure the battery connections are tight. . Solar battery maintenance generally includes ensuring the battery is operating in the right temperature range, checking connections for signs of corrosion or looseness, and monitoring the battery's charge level to prevent it from getting too high or too low.
